Patents by Inventor Simon J. Daniels

Simon J. Daniels has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 7251778
    Abstract: Dynamically adapting the layout of a document to a particular output device. The layout of a document can be adapted to a particular output device so that the document fully utilizes the capabilities of the output device. A layout generator interrogates the output device to determine the capabilities of the output device. Based upon the capabilities of the output device, the layout generator selects a style sheet to accommodate the particular output device. The style sheet assigns values to format properties such as font properties, color and background properties, and text properties. The layout of the document is adapted to the particular output device by rendering the document on the output device using the values defined in the style sheet.
    Type: Grant
    Filed: January 10, 2000
    Date of Patent: July 31, 2007
    Assignee: Microsoft Corporation
    Inventors: William Hill, Simon D. Earnshaw, Simon J. Daniels, David M. Meltzer
  • Patent number: 6023714
    Abstract: Dynamically adapting the layout of a document to a particular output device. The layout of a document can be adapted to a particular output device so that the document fully utilizes the capabilities of the output device. A layout generator interrogates the output device to determine the capabilities of the output device. Based upon the capabilities of the output device, the layout generator selects a style sheet to accommodate the particular output device. The style sheet assigns values to format properties such as font properties, color and background properties, and text properties. The layout of the document is adapted to the particular output device by rendering the document on the output device using the values defined in the style sheet.
    Type: Grant
    Filed: April 24, 1997
    Date of Patent: February 8, 2000
    Assignee: Microsoft Corporation
    Inventors: William Hill, Simon D. Earnshaw, Simon J. Daniels, David M. Meltzer